Overview
The DPC817S-D-TR is a single-channel phototransistor output optocoupler manufactured by Diodes Incorporated. It features 5000 VRMS input-output isolation voltage and operates within a temperature range of -55°C to +110°C. Key electrical parameters include a maximum collector-emitter voltage of 35 V, a forward current of 5 mA, and a forward voltage of 1.25 V. The device exhibits a high current transfer ratio with a maximum value of 600% and a power dissipation rating of 200 mW.

Procurement Notes
Verify the specific suffix 'D' corresponds to the required Current Transfer Ratio bin, as variants like A, B, and S exist with different CTR specifications. Confirm package type SL-4 and tape-and-reel quantity match design requirements. Ensure compliance with RoHS directives if applicable to the target market. Cross-reference datasheet revisions to confirm thermal and electrical limits remain unchanged for production integration.
Selection Notes
Select this component when high current transfer ratio is critical for driving loads with minimal input current. Compare against lower CTR variants such as the A or B series if cost optimization outweighs performance needs. Verify that the 35 V collector-emitter voltage meets the load requirements. Consider the SL-4 package dimensions for PCB layout constraints and ensure thermal management supports the 200 mW dissipation limit under worst-case conditions.
Part Context
This part belongs to the DPC817S family of transistor output optocouplers from Diodes Incorporated. The family shares common isolation voltages and package styles but differs in Current Transfer Ratio bins. The D variant specifically targets applications demanding higher gain compared to standard 817 equivalents, offering enhanced signal integrity in noise-sensitive environments while maintaining compatibility with standard surface-mount processes.
Replacement Considerations
Direct substitutes include other DPC817S-D-TR units from authorized distributors. Alternative brands may offer similar SL-4 optocouplers, but verify pinout compatibility and CTR specifications carefully. Generic 817 replacements often have lower CTR and may require circuit adjustments. Ensure any substitute matches the 5000 VRMS isolation rating and -55°C to +110°C temperature range.
